Factors Affecting Mobile Home Prices:
- Location: Proximity to beaches, major highways, and desirable amenities significantly impacts price. Mobile home parks closer to these areas tend to command higher prices.
- Condition of the Home: The age, condition, and features of the mobile home itself are crucial. Newer homes with updated interiors and appliances will naturally cost more than older, less well-maintained ones.
- Size and Features: Larger homes with more bedrooms and bathrooms, modern appliances, and desirable features (like screened-in porches) will be more expensive.
- Lot Rent: The monthly fee charged by the mobile home park for renting the land is a significant ongoing cost. Consider this factor when evaluating the overall affordability of a mobile home.
- Market Demand: Like any real estate market, supply and demand play a critical role. High demand and low supply lead to higher prices.
Finding Cheap Mobile Homes: Strategies and Resources
Finding truly “cheap” mobile homes in Palm Beach County requires a strategic approach and a willingness to explore various resources. Simply relying on major real estate websites may not yield the best results.
Effective Search Strategies:
- Check Local Classifieds: Browse local newspapers, online classifieds websites (like Craigslist), and community bulletin boards. These often feature listings not found on major real estate portals.
- Visit Mobile Home Parks Directly: Many parks have management offices that keep track of available homes for sale within their community. Contacting them directly can uncover hidden opportunities.
- Network: Talk to friends, family, and colleagues. Word-of-mouth referrals can lead to great deals that aren’t publicly advertised.
- Utilize Mobile Home Specific Websites: Several websites specialize in mobile home listings. These platforms often cater to a more budget-conscious buyer.
- Be Flexible with Location: Consider areas slightly further from the beach or major cities. This can significantly reduce costs.
Potential Challenges and Considerations
While buying a cheap mobile home in Palm Beach County can offer significant financial advantages, it’s essential to be aware of potential drawbacks.
Challenges to Consider:
- Older Homes and Repairs: Cheap mobile homes are often older and may require significant repairs or upgrades. Budget for these unforeseen expenses.
- Lot Rent Increases: Mobile home park lot rent can increase over time, affecting your monthly expenses. Carefully review the park’s lease agreement.
- Park Rules and Regulations: Each park has its own set of rules and regulations. Ensure you understand and agree with these before purchasing.
- Resale Value: The resale value of mobile homes can be unpredictable, particularly older models. Factor this into your long-term financial planning.
- Financing: Securing financing for a mobile home can be more challenging than for traditional homes. Explore your financing options early in the process.
